Krütex 200 Temperature: -50°C ...+130°C Speed:= 1.0 m/s Fluids: Hydraulic fluids (mineral oil based), water emulsions Compression strength: 340 N/mm² Friction coefficient: 0,05 Krütex 100 Temperature: -50°C ...+120°C Speed:= 0,5 m/s Fluids: Hydraulic fluids (mineral oil based), water emulsions Compression strength: 270 N/mm² Friction coefficient: 0,25 Calculating radial load FR = (D x L x q / v )x n FR= maximum radial load (N) q = compression strength at operating temperature for the given compound (N/mm) D x L = diameter x seal width (mm) n = number of rings v = confidence coefficient (recommendation> 3) Materials Phenol resin and synthetic fabric laminated together as layers. This structure guarantees high torsion strength and elasticity. Including PTFE gives better gliding properties (Krütex200). Dimensional accuracy is improved by extremely low water absorption properties of the material (< 0,1%). Advantages - High mechanical durability - High temperature resistance - High wear and aging resistance - Easy to assemble - Low friction - High weight-carrying capacity - High surface harness Cord length Cord length: A = 3,14 x B - M - Gap M from table - B = guide rings effective diameter - Piston B = øH - L - Rod B = øH + L - L = Depth of housing Installation The guide ring is stretched open when assembled into the groove Attention! The gap behind the seal is chosen seal specifically according to operating conditions. |
